S-1165B30MC-N6PTFU is a low dropout linear voltage regulator that operates by comparing the output voltage with a reference voltage. It adjusts the resistance in the pass transistor to maintain a stable output voltage, compensating for changes in input voltage and load conditions. The regulator continuously monitors the output voltage and adjusts its operation accordingly.
